Call is made from a nice piece of padauk. It's slate over glass. Striker is two piece with bloodwood used for business end.

I've been making pot calls for about 10 years. Usually about 15-20 each year. I'm a machinist/toolmaker by trade that enjoys making turkey calls and hunting turkeys. Each call and striker are done on a small engine lathe, one at a time.
